Delete History for Safari greyed out

The delete safari history option in settings is greyed out even though I have removed the restrictions in screen time - is there something else that needs to be done to re-activate this option ?.

When there's no history or website data to clear, the setting turns gray. The setting might also be gray if you have web content restrictions set up under Content & Privacy Restrictions in Screen Time


If you have history you can't delete and you've ensured you don't have web content restrictions set up in Screentime, is your iPad under MDM (Mobile Device Management) software from an employer?
